Pre-game story: South Hills (1-2) vs. Monrovia (1-2), Covina District Field, 7 p.m. Monrovia and South Hills high schools are in unfamiliar territory heading into tonight’s football showdown at Covina District Field. The programs have established themselves as area powers, but each enters tonight’s game with a 1-2 record and some regret to go with it.

The Inland Insider, Chino Hills Tom, will provide video highlights and interviews soon after, we will post around midnight.

Robledo’s thoughts: Is it bigger for Monrovia or South Hills? Without a doubt the Huskies. As much as the Wildcats need to show it can defeat an upper divisional team, let alone a divisional rival after losses to Glendora and San Dimas, the Huskies can’t afford a loss to a Mid-Valley Divisional team it’s supposed to defeat going into a bye week before the brutal Sierra League, where in reality, you would probably pick them to finish last or second to last at this point. The Cats will go on and win the Rio Hondo League and fight for a divisional title, so a loss while painful, won’t be as devastating as a Huskies loss. On paper, I like South Hills anyway, they’re bigger up front, have a backfield that won’t be stopped, and if all they really have to do is key in on Nick Bueno, the best athlete on the field, they can do that. Prediction: South Hills 28, Monrovia 14

Thursday’s Results West Covina 42, South Hills 27 — Would someone send the Covina tape, I’m having a hard time comprehending how they pulled it off after watching West Covina dismantle South Hills every way imaginable. You weren’t thinking what happened to South Hills, you were more in awe of the Bulldogs’ backfiled and 0-Line. It was the most points scored on South Hills this decade. If this team doesn’t turn the ball over, they won’t get beat the rest of the way, and that includes Glendora next. Last week it was RB Chris Soloman, this week it was B.J. Lee (125 yards, 3 TDs), and next week it could be someone else. They’re that deep, and were better than I thought on the D-Line. What you don’t know is how they will handle a quarterback like Glendora’s Chad Jeffries. But questions about everything else were answered tonight, a big thumbs up. Azusa 31, Ontario Christian 10 – Fine I’ll say it: The Aztecs can compete with anyone in the Mid-Valley Division. There is not a game they won’t have a chance to win, so yes, a Mid-Valley title is possible. Especially with QB Jose “The Real Deal” Nunez, who scored four touchdowns and threw for 207 yards. Garey 49, Duarte 10 — It doesn’t show on the scoreboard, but the Falcons go down fighting every week.

South Hills has a schedule that goes like this, Baldwin Park, West Covina, Tesoro, Monrovia, Los Osos, Damien, Ayala, Chino Hills, Claremont and the finale with Charter Oak. It’s a monster obviously, and one that will surely test the Huskies, who have lost at least two transfers to Charter Oak, two to Bishop Amat and another to a potential season-ending injury, that being WR/DB Jamie Canada, who will have knee surgery next month. But don’t feel sorry for the Huskies, not when your offensive line boasts Peter Nonu, Sioasi Aiono and Jeff Vargas, not to mention QB Vincent Hernandez and RB Jamel Hart. But will the Huskies have the depth and enough bodies to compete in the powerful Sierra? Will they have solid enough replacements to fill the voids of the departed? That’s what they’re going to find out.
